Edit D:\app\Administrator\product\11.2.0\dbhome_1\oc4j\javacache\lib\oracle\ias\cache\group\Monitor.class
?? .[ e ? d ? d ? d ? d ? d ? ? ? ? d ? d ? d ? d ? ? ? d ? ? d ? d ? ? ? ? N e ? ? ? ? ? ? ? d ? d 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? / ? ? / ? / 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 9 ? ? 9 ? 9 ? ? 9 ? ? 9 ? ? ? d ? ? ? ? ? ? ? ? ? H ? F ? ? ? F ? ? ? F ? ? ? ? ? ? ? / ? ? ? ? ? ? d ? ? ? ? ? d ? e ? ? ? ? ? ? a ? ? ? ? LOGGER_NAME Ljava/lang/String; ConstantValue SECONDS I FACTOR MIN_READ J work Z long_lock [B lastPinged lock pendingReply Ljava/util/HashSet; counter isPause_ gcomm_ )Loracle/ias/cache/group/GrpCommunication; trans_ "Loracle/ias/cache/group/Transport; logger_ Ljava/util/logging/Logger; <init> N(Loracle/ias/cache/group/GrpCommunication;Loracle/ias/cache/group/Transport;)V Code run ()V ping Exceptions ? gotReply #(Loracle/ias/cache/group/Address;)V gotPinged check toPause reset stopit terminateRemoteMember ? ? r s u s v w x o y q oracle.ias.cache.group.Monitor ? ? ? ~ p q z { | } ? ? ? t o Group Monitor ? java/lang/InterruptedException ? ? ? ? %oracle/ias/cache/commx/GroupException Monitor Exception: java/lang/Exception g ? !"#$ ?%& '()* java/util/HashSet ?+,-./012 oracle/ias/cache/group/Address3456789:; java/lang/StringBuffer No PING_ACK from <=<> and <? ! recent packets: declare it dead.@AB ? ?C ? oracle/ias/cache/group/PacketD java/lang/Long ? ?EFGHIJK ?LMNOPC8Q ? "Haven't got PING message and only - recent packets. Declare Coordinator Dead at ? ?Q ?R ?S ?T ?UVWXY oracle/ias/cache/group/EndPointZ +Warning, can't remotely terminate member at oracle/ias/cache/group/Monitor java/lang/Thread java/io/IOException java/util/logging/Logger getLogger .(Ljava/lang/String;)Ljava/util/logging/Logger; java/lang/System currentTimeMillis ()J setName (Ljava/lang/String;)V setDaemon (Z)V java/lang/Object wait sleep (J)V oracle/ias/cache/group/Transport getFailureDetector *()Loracle/ias/cache/group/FailureDetector; &oracle/ias/cache/group/FailureDetector getCoordinator "()Loracle/ias/cache/group/Address; isMyself #(Loracle/ias/cache/group/Address;)Z java/util/logging/Level WARNING Ljava/util/logging/Level; isLoggable (Ljava/util/logging/Level;)Z log C(Ljava/util/logging/Level;Ljava/lang/String;Ljava/lang/Throwable;)V getGroupManager '()Loracle/ias/cache/group/GroupManager; #oracle/ias/cache/group/GroupManager SYSTEM_GROUP getLatestViewInfoRWLock 3(Ljava/lang/String;)Loracle/ias/cache/group/RWLock; oracle/ias/cache/group/RWLock acquireReadLock getLatestViewInfo 5(Ljava/lang/String;)Loracle/ias/cache/group/ViewInfo; oracle/ias/cache/group/ViewInfo getView ()Loracle/ias/cache/group/View; releaseReadLock getCurrentViewInfoRWLock getCurrentViewInfo getMessageBuffer (()Loracle/ias/cache/group/MessageBuffer; size ()I (Ljava/util/Collection;)V iterator ()Ljava/util/Iterator; java/util/Iterator hasNext ()Z next ()Ljava/lang/Object; oracle/ias/cache/group/View getMembers ()Ljava/util/Vector; java/util/Vector contains (Ljava/lang/Object;)Z getRecentReadOf #(Loracle/ias/cache/group/Address;)J SEVERE append ,(Ljava/lang/String;)Ljava/lang/StringBuffer; ,(Ljava/lang/Object;)Ljava/lang/StringBuffer; (J)Ljava/lang/StringBuffer; toString ()Ljava/lang/String; .(Ljava/util/logging/Level;Ljava/lang/String;)V remove getLocalAddress R(IILoracle/ias/cache/group/Address;Ljava/io/Serializable;Ljava/io/Serializable;J)V $oracle/ias/cache/group/MessageBuffer getStableVector ()[J setReceiveArray ([J)V getReceivedTONumber setReceivedTONumber setUpdated multicast F(Loracle/ias/cache/group/Packet;)Loracle/ias/cache/group/GrpReplyInfo; #oracle/ias/cache/group/GrpReplyInfo resetRecentCounter notifyAll interrupt yield getEndPointList ()Ljava/util/Hashtable; java/util/Hashtable get &(Ljava/lang/Object;)Ljava/lang/Object; close d e f g h i j h k l j h m n o h , p q r s t o u s v w x o y q z { | } ~ ? ? ? { _*? *?? *?? *? * ? *? *? ? *? *+? *,? *? YN?*? ? -? :-??*? *? ? @ I L L P L ? ? ? ? ?*? ? ?*? YL?*? ? *? ? ? M+? N+?-? ? *? *? ? ? ? ? *? ? *? *Y? a? ????*? ? ? ? *? ? +? ??*? ? ? ? *? ? +? ?g? "